Compensation method for intelligent antenna system after failure of part of channels

The present invention discloses a method for compensating when part of channels in the intelligent antenna system lapses. The invention aims at the problem that the downward beam shaping capacity of the intelligent antennae will dramatically decline when a certain or a plurality of channels in the intelligent antenna system lapse. The compensating method of the invention in the intelligent antenna system when part channels lapse comprises the steps of: (1) obtaining the number of the disabled ascending descending channels, the disabled channel number and the lapse style; (2) sharing equally the business of all the user covered by the intelligent antenna system to each effective descending antenna to transmit if the lapse style is that the shaping antenna of the special channel is damaged; and choosing the channel with the maximal transmitting power in the effective descending channel or adapting the common signal channel to compensate the weight by the descending beam shaping weight if the lapse style is that the shaping antenna of the common signal channel is damaged. The invention perfects the covering of the intelligent antenna system to the small district and increases the capacity of the small district and the speech quality of the user.

Accompanied channel resource allocation method and device

The application provides an associated channel resource allocation method, which is realized through a wireless network controller. The associated channel resource allocation method comprises the steps of: receiving a request transmitted by a terminal for constructing packet service, and allocating high-speed downlink packet access resource; acquiring the terminal identification code from the request; and determining whether the terminal exists in a pre-stored list prohibiting using channel frame division multiplexing according to the terminal identification code, allocating the associated channel frame division multiplexing resource to the terminal if the terminal does not exist in the list, otherwise, allocating other resource to the terminal. The application also provides an associated channel resource allocation device for realizing the method. The associated channel resource allocation method and device provided by the application can pre-determine the terminal according to the list so as to allocate resources according to the actual condition, thereby improving cell capacity, obviating call drop, balancing the cell capacity and the call drop, improving utilization rate of network resources, and ensuring normal conduction of the terminal data service.

A method and device for receiving long scrambling codes for time division duplex system trunking services

The invention relates to a method for receiving a long scrambling code of a downstream cluster service in a time division duplex communication system, which comprises the steps as follows: a base station broadcasts and transmits system data information with the long scrambling code to a target user group in the cell; user equipment estimates channel impulse responses for training sequences in the cell and in the neighboring cells according to the received system data information to obtain the channel impulse responses corresponding to each cell; the power of the channel impulse responses of each cell is estimated to obtain the power of the channel impulse responses corresponding to each cell, and the power of the channel impulse responses is sorted to determine the cells with effective receptions; and the rake reception and interference elimination, demodulation and decoding process are carried out cell by cell to the cells with effective receptions so as to obtain expected user data. Based on the method, the invention also provides a receiver-transmitter unit for realizing the method. The invention effectively overcomes the multi-cell interference, so as to improve the transmission performance of the cluster mass-sending service and the cell capacity.

Transmitting and receiving method and apparatus for group sending service in radio communication system

The invention relates to a sending and receiving method of a group sending service in a wireless communication system, the method includes the steps: step 1, a base station sends data to target user groups in a local cell by broadcasting and the target user group comprises at least one user equipment; step 2, each local cell is provided with a training sequence and the base station adopts the same training sequence to send data to the user groups in the local cell; step 3, the user equipment obtains channel impulse response corresponding to each cell according to the information of each cell; step 4, the user equipment carries out power evaluation on the channel impulse response of each cell; a code division channel is selected according to the result of power evaluation and threshold requirement, spread spectrum codes and disturbing codes corresponding to the selected code division channel as well as the corresponding channel impulse response form a system matrix; step 5, the user equipment conducts a joint detection on the system matrix to obtain expected data of a target user equipment. The sending and receiving method of the invention can effectively control the disturbance among users as well as among cells in group sending service.
